Entro em uma pasta e as vezes preciso listar somente os diretórios existe algum comando tipo o dir /ad do dos. Acredito que deva haver algo melhor do que o antiquado dir com muitos outros recursos, já olhei o man do ls mas não achei nada semelhante o que quero, fiz vários testes mas não descobri a sintaxe ainda, caso alguém saiba por favor me diga.
- Home
- >
- Fórum
- >
- GNU-Linux, Free...
- >
- Outros temas GN...
- >
- Existe Comando p/ Listar...
putz agora tô no trampo mas se eu ainda me lembro...
ls -F <-F maiúsculo mesmo
Xterminator-againputz agora tô no trampo mas se eu ainda me lembro...
ls -F <-F maiúsculo mesmo
So acrescentando... ele vai listar todo o conteudo e as pastas vc identifica com a barra do lado.EX:. dev/.
abrs.
presleySo acrescentando... ele vai listar todo o conteudo e as pastas vc identifica com a barra do lado.EX:. dev/.
...
Só acrescentando:
Aqui o ls normal já mostra a / :wink:
presleySo acrescentando... ele vai listar todo o conteudo e as pastas vc identifica com a barra do lado.EX:. dev/.
...
Então fica fácil:
ls -lF | grep "/"
Mas o meu ls normalmente não poe "/" não, ele coloca os diretórios em azul, os executáveis em verde, os links simbólicos em ciano e os arquivos de texto em branco. O resto fica em cinza. Ah! Dispositivos em amarelo, links simbólicos quebrados em preto sob fundo vermelho.
"chmod 777 nunca ajudou ninguém" (c) 2002-2021 JQueiroz/FGdH
Conheça o Blog do Zekke
JohnEntro em uma pasta e as vezes preciso listar somente os diretórios existe algum comando tipo o dir /ad do dos. Acredi...
tem um comando tree que permite ver os diretorios em modo arvore:
tree -d
visualiza somente diretórios
tree -L 1
visualiza somente um nível seguinte, o default é visualizuar tudo no diretório corrente
Valeu galera já tá anotado, muito obrigado.
In God We Trust.
Slackware 10
K6-2 500 (Onboard) 314Mb
Caramba daqui a pouco o pessoal escreve um script pra mostrar a listagem so de diretorios. Pra que complicar se tem o comando
$ ls -D :-)
man ls (tem inumeras opcoes)
Cada vez acho mais que quem mexe com linux fica doido, tem tanto jeito de fazer a mesma coisa que o pessoal vai pelo caminho mais dificil
Mobile: HP NX9010
Red Hat Certified Engineer - LPIC-2
Red Hat Enterprise AS v3.0 / Slackware 10 / FreeBSD 4.9-STABLE
Default®Caramba daqui a pouco o pessoal escreve um script pra mostrar a listagem so de diretorios. Pra que complicar se tem o...
Seu lá cara...
eu tb pensei que fosse simples, mas aqui no CL só funfa com um script mesmo, huahuahau:
[tiago@bender tiago]$ ls
127258260.history behind_a.wsz hunger.txt lilo screenshot2.png
Desktop carta.kwd imagens mail slakware
GNUstep download licq.htm mulheraosol.jpg temas
Wallpapers evolution licq_files nsmail tmp
[tiago@bender tiago]$ ls -D
127258260.history behind_a.wsz hunger.txt lilo screenshot2.png
Desktop carta.kwd imagens mail slakware
GNUstep download licq.htm mulheraosol.jpg temas
Wallpapers evolution licq_files nsmail tmp
Mesma coisa... :-/
Tiago CruzSeu lá cara...
eu tb pensei que fosse simples, mas aqui no CL só funfa com um script mesmo, huahuahau:
[code][...
E voce esta certo eu testei esse comando aqui
ls -D
num diretorio que so tinha diretorios mesmo GARGALHADAS e por isso deu certo ,ninguem mandou eu ler o topico e so digitar ls -D sem ler manual . O que acontece qdo voce nao le manual ? TOMA na cabeca :-)
Mobile: HP NX9010
Red Hat Certified Engineer - LPIC-2
Red Hat Enterprise AS v3.0 / Slackware 10 / FreeBSD 4.9-STABLE
Default®E voce esta certo eu testei esse comando aqui
ls -D
num diretorio que so tinha diretorios mesmo GARGALHADAS e por ...
Agora fiquei com isso na cabeça.... :roll:
jqueirozEntão fica fácil:
ls -lF | grep "/"
Mas o meu ls normalmente não poe "/" não, ele coloca os diretórios em azul...
Ae gente:
ls -d */
Credo... nunca vi tanta treta para uma coisa tão simples :mrgreen:
Ai galera, se quer facilitar mais ainda, coloca esse comando no .basrc, ou no .bash_profile, depende da distribuição
alias lsd="ls -lF | grep /"
ai é so digitar lsd que vai aparecer somente os diretorios como jqueiroz disse.
Att
João Schmutz